Fabricate
Fabricate is a verb with several related senses. It most commonly means to make or construct something from raw materials or components by shaping, assembling, or welding. It can also refer to the process of producing a manufactured product in a factory or workshop, often described as fabrication. A third sense is to invent or contrive something, such as a story, claim, or piece of evidence, typically with the implication of deceit.
